Well you need to understand the behavior of h-reap or what it's called now, FlexConnect. In this mode, the clients are still remembers on the WLC until the session timer/idle timer expires. So switching between SSID's in h-reap will not be the same when switching when the AP's are in local mode.
Take a look at the client when connected in FlexConnect in the WLC GUI monitor tab. Thus will show you what ssid and vlan the client is on. Now switch to a different ssid and compare this. It's probably the same because the client has not timed out. Now go back to the other ssid and look again. Now on the WLC, remove or delete the client and then switch to the other ssid at the same time. Or switch SSID's and then remove the client. The client will join the new ssid and in the monitor tab, you should see the info.
There is no need to have clients have multiple SSID's unless your testing. Devices should only have one ssid profile configured to eliminate any connectivity issues from the device wanting to switch SSID's.

how do I switch between windows in the same programme? I know that I can use Command tab, however this takes you through all of the programmes that I'm using. What I need to do is have a shortcut to switch between windows in the same programme. For example if I'm in Excel and have 5 windows open I want to be able to scroll between each window of Excel only with a shortcut.
Please help!Command and ~ keys to tab between open windows.
Technically it is the Grave Accent ` (aka reverse quote) under the tilda ~ key. Tilda ~ is shifted, and Grave Accent ` is not.

Restore database in the same server but with other sid (name)
i try to restore the database in the same server but with other sid (name) . The backup is on tape and
I want to know the steps I should follow.
thank.To perform restore of database in same host to choose another DB name you can go for
1) duplicate using RMAN.
Directory structure should be different so take care of db_file_name_convert & log_file_name_convert parameters
Also check the Tns services exactly is it pointing to target & auxiliary
